Inspector Notes
A monitoring inspection was conducted today. The provider was caring for one child, equaling 4 points. The child was observed playing with toys, interacting with the provider, and preparing for lunch. This child's lunch is provided by the parent and brought from home.
The Inspector reviewed compliance in the areas of the physical plant, programming, child nutrition, caregiver training, emergency preparedness, and administrative records.

Violations
1Evidence:
Child record A does not include the information for a second emergency contact who is not a parent. This file includes the father's information for the emergency contact.
